3.7.1 Data transfer to other controllers
Principally, your personal data is forwarded to other controllers only if required for the fulfillment of a contractual obligation, or if we ourselves, or a third party, have a legitimate interest in the data transfer, or if you have given your consent. Particulars on the legal basis and the recipients or categories of recipients can be found in the Section - Processing purposes and legal basis. Additionally, data may be transferred to other controllers when we are obliged to do so due to statutory regulations or enforceable administrative or judicial orders.



Sounds like its up to Alby what they do with your personal data let alone be demanded by a government. The fact they collect any data on their users is the problem. I use Alby myself but in a very sandboxed way. I wouldn't want my browsing history being tied to my lightning payment history. However, I cannot read the code. I'm just reading what they provide in their privacy policy. Alby is very usuful, but people shouldn't assume they have any privacy using the extension
